Cemil Tugay fulfills his promise! Halk Ekmek price in İzmir drops to 5 TL

İzmir Metropolitan Municipality Mayor Dr. Cemil Tugay has kept his pre-election promise to lower bread prices.

İzmir Metropolitan Municipality Mayor Dr. Cemil Tugay has fulfilled the promise he made during the election process regarding a reduction in bread prices. With his first directive following the holiday break, he lowered the price of Halk Ekmek products from 7 TL to 5 TL.

According to the report in BirGün, the price reduction promised before the March 31 local elections will be implemented by the Halk Ekmek Factory under the İzmir Metropolitan Municipality's Grand Plaza Gıda Turizm A.Ş., and it was stated that residents of İzmir will be able to purchase bread for 5 TL starting from Tuesday, April 16.

The statement from İzmir Metropolitan Municipality Mayor Dr. Cemil Tugay is as follows:

“The economic difficulties experienced in our country have reduced purchasing power and put our citizens in financial distress. To alleviate these difficulties to some extent, to ease budgets, and to provide convenience to our citizens who have difficulty buying bread, which is a staple on our tables, we have lowered the prices at Halk Ekmek. The 120 thousand loaves of bread to be produced daily will be offered for sale at 5 TL at our kiosks operating in 93 locations across our city, starting with tomorrow morning's first shipments. We will overcome these difficult days together and continue to stand by our people in every matter.”
